BIOGEOCHEMICAL EXPLORATION METHOD Russian patent published in 2000 - IPC

Abstract RU 2150722 C1

FIELD: geological exploration. SUBSTANCE: method is designed for geochemical exploration of gold and other metals' fields on territories characterizing by the presence of birch to increase contrast of gold anomalies compared to its background concentrations. Method consists in that, on specified territory, one collects equal-area strips of bark from lower parts of stems of wart and flat-leaf species of birch with diameter 20-30 cm. Samples are then ashed and ashes are analyzed for content of minerals indicative of mineralization. Results of analysis are the duly interpreted to reveal searched anomalies. EFFECT: facilitated exploration. 2 cl
